> I am pleased to announce a long overdue release of jackEQ v0.5.8 code
> name: Smooth and Shiny
>
> You can find the tarball at the new home: http://djcj.org/jackeq
>
> It's been almost 4 years since a release and this one comes with many
> useful new features including...
>
> - Save/Restore UI state (with autosave on exit/quit).
> - Shiny new meters merging gtkmeter and gtkmeterscale into one class.
> - Mute buttons on all channels, right click to enable/disable.
> - One click eq reset (well two actually for your safety)
> - A revised UI theme taking advantage of Cairo rendering engine in gtk.
> Mmmm gradients.
